So before doing this i did use TachiyomiAT, but when the translation were done and i opened the manga, all i could see were big white boxes with the translations done, they are currenlty working on updating the app.

To integrate it with mihon took a while, basically as u/ANR2ME suggested you use the suwayomi server extension, but that extension only showed manga that I had added to my library, not the translated one.

So i made a different pipeline, where once the downloads were done on pc, they would then be synced to my local folder inside Mihon and i could read the translated manga from my "Local Source" and you can read it like any other manga, instead of reading it from the WebView of Suwayomi extension.
